TheType 054A (NATO/OSDJiangkai II) is aclass of guided-missilefrigate from thePeople's Republic of China. It is a development of theType 054 frigate;[6] compared to its predecessor, the Type 054A has medium-range air defense capability in the form ofType 382 radar andvertically launched (VLS)HHQ-16surface-to-air missiles.[7]

The first ship (Xuzhou) of the new Type 054A was laid down in 2005 and entered service with thePeople's Liberation Army Navy (PLAN) in January 2008;[4] the class was a key component of the PLAN's surface fleet by the late 2010s.[8][9][10] Production was ongoing in 2023, with 30 ships in service by mid 2019, while the next batch of 10 ships commissioned from 2022 onwards, and a final batch of 10 ships under development,[3][11] although this last batch may be built to the follow-onType 054B (Jiangkai III) design.[12]

Design

[edit]

The Type 054 was heavily influenced by theLa Fayette-classfrigate fromFrance, and so reflected the strategic and operational requirements of that country. The development of the Type 054A may have been driven by China's need to address high-intensity armed conflict.[13]

The Type 054A uses the same stealthy hull form as the Type 054.[6] The forward launcher forHQ-7 short-range SAM[14] is replaced with a 32-cellvertical launching system[4] for medium-range HHQ-16 SAMs and Yu-8 antisubmarine rockets.[6] The smaller main gun andType 730close-in weapon system (CIWS) are also installed.[4]

The radar suite makes use of technologyreverse engineered from Russian systems; the affected Chinese systems may include theH/LJQ-382 air search radar (from the Fregat MAE-3) and theH/LJQ-366 fire control radar (from the Mineral ME).[15][16][6] The HHQ-16 target illuminators may also be derived from the Russian MR-90.[17][16][6]

Ships starting with the 17th unit (Huanggang) were constructed with enhancedanti-submarine warfare capability - addingvariable depth and towed array sonar - and the Type 1130 CIWS instead of the Type 730.[6][18] These ships have been unofficially referred to asType 054A+,Type 054A2, ormodified Jiangkai II.[6]

In 2015, Gabe Collins estimated that each ship costUS$348 million.[8]

Operational history

[edit]

Type 054As have regularly deployed beyond China's regional waters.[9]

Ships have participated inanti-piracy naval patrols offSomalia. The first wasHuangshan, which deployed as part of China's second rotation in April 2019. From there, the ships have been detached to respond to regional crises. Frigates evacuated Chinese citizens fromLibya in 2011 - makingXuzhou the first PLAN ship to enter theMediterranean Sea - andYemen in 2015. Another joined an international effort tosecure Syria's chemical weapons in 2014.[9]

Frigates also participated in the first Chinese naval exercises with theRussian Navy in the Mediterranean in 2015 and theBaltic Sea in 2017.[9]

Exports

[edit]

In January 2013, it was confirmed that China offered three Type 054As to theRoyal Thai Navy for US$1 billion.[19] Ultimately, Thailand selected a derivative of theSouth KoreanGwanggaeto the Great-class destroyer fromDaewoo Shipbuilding & Marine Engineering.[20]

Pakistan ordered four Type 054A variants fromHudong-Zhonghua Shipbuilding in 2017-2018 as the Type 054A/P, orTughril class. The first entered service on 8 November 2021, and all four were commissioned by mid 2022.[21]
